The simple idea is entering the country without proper authorization, i.e., a visa, or remaining in the country after the visa has expired. That is why the polite term that has arisen is "undocumented workers." Obviously, if one sneaks (or is smuggled) into the country, he is very unlikely to have obtained proper authorization. If one enters the country on a tourist visa or a student visa, the authorization will last only a limited time. The term "illegal immigrant" arises when the entry is illegal or when an authorized visit becomes something more permanent.
